How they compare
Indonesia currently reports 10.7% against 10.6% in Hungary, a difference of 0.1%.
Across all 26 years both countries report, Indonesia has been ahead every year.
Hungary ranks 132nd and Indonesia ranks 131st of 230 countries.
Indonesia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Hungary | Indonesia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.7% | 17.3% | 16.6% | Indonesia |
| 2000s | 3.4% | 14.1% | 10.7% | Indonesia |
| 2010s | 9.0% | 12.2% | 3.3% | Indonesia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
